India vs Bangladesh 1st T20: Players practice in Delhi
India and Bangladesh engage in practice session at the Arun Jaitley Stadium. Most of Bangladesh players came out wearing masks to protect themselves from the toxic air quality in Delhi while the Indian players participated in a routine practice session.
